The Emperor of Weehawken

http://www.weehawkenhistory.us/timemachine/files/original/dba8be839b4584a73811ca2f093d8fc2.jpg
From the February, 1976 issue of DC Comics' Weird War, this story shows Weehawken 700 years 'after the Bomb' as a medieval kingdom with its own Emperor.
